Node.js中如何实现基于token的用户认证机制?

2026-04-03 10:410阅读0评论SEO问题
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1022个文字,预计阅读时间需要5分钟。

Node.js中如何实现基于token的用户认证机制?

原文:本文字只介绍简单的应用,关于JSON Web Token的具体介绍及原理请参考曹一峰老师的JSON Web Token入门教程。使用的Node框架是koa2,前端发送ajax请求使用axios,首先创建工程目录:static中存放‘‘

简要介绍JSON Web Token的应用,具体内容与原理请参阅曹一峰老师的《JSON Web Token入门教程》。项目使用koa2作为后端框架,前端通过axios发送ajax请求。初始化项目目录:在static文件夹中存放相关资源。

本文只介绍简单的应用,关于json web token的具体介绍以及原理请参考阮一峰老师的JSON Web Token 入门教程。

使用的Node框架是koa2,前端发送ajax请求使用axios

首先创建工程目录:


static中存放静态资源,views存放前端模板,server.js为后端代码。

安装必要的依赖项:

"dependencies": { "@koa/router": "^8.0.8", "jsonwebtoken": "^8.5.1", "koa": "^2.12.0", "koa-bodyparser": "^4.3.0", "koa-ejs": "^4.3.0", "koa-jwt": "^4.0.0", "koa-static": "^5.0.0", "koa-views": "^6.2.2" }

在server.js中添加代码来创建一个简单的后端程序,由于网上有太多相关示例代码,在此不再赘述。

阅读全文
标签:简单

本文共计1022个文字,预计阅读时间需要5分钟。

Node.js中如何实现基于token的用户认证机制?

原文:本文字只介绍简单的应用,关于JSON Web Token的具体介绍及原理请参考曹一峰老师的JSON Web Token入门教程。使用的Node框架是koa2,前端发送ajax请求使用axios,首先创建工程目录:static中存放‘‘

简要介绍JSON Web Token的应用,具体内容与原理请参阅曹一峰老师的《JSON Web Token入门教程》。项目使用koa2作为后端框架,前端通过axios发送ajax请求。初始化项目目录:在static文件夹中存放相关资源。

本文只介绍简单的应用,关于json web token的具体介绍以及原理请参考阮一峰老师的JSON Web Token 入门教程。

使用的Node框架是koa2,前端发送ajax请求使用axios

首先创建工程目录:


static中存放静态资源,views存放前端模板,server.js为后端代码。

安装必要的依赖项:

"dependencies": { "@koa/router": "^8.0.8", "jsonwebtoken": "^8.5.1", "koa": "^2.12.0", "koa-bodyparser": "^4.3.0", "koa-ejs": "^4.3.0", "koa-jwt": "^4.0.0", "koa-static": "^5.0.0", "koa-views": "^6.2.2" }

在server.js中添加代码来创建一个简单的后端程序,由于网上有太多相关示例代码,在此不再赘述。

阅读全文
标签:简单